Squirrel Guard Squirrel Multi-Catch Animal Trap – Live Animal Trap for Squirrels and Small rodents

$34.37

Squirrel Guard Squirrel Multi-Catch Animal Trap – Live Animal Trap for Squirrels and Small rodents

$34.37